> Now we run our internal mission critical app on 4.5, our intranet on > 6.1 and 5 odd websites on 4.5. We have CF server crashes more than > you can imagine, and I hope 7 will be able to go some way to helping > us out.
Can you be very specific about the crashes? In CFMX 6.x, 7 you don't have to worry about stability suffering from "unlocked shared scope variable" usage. This was a leading killer in CF5 and 4.5 since developer would have to properly use CFLOCK with session and application scopes throughout the entire app, or else you would end up with memory corruption having the symptoms of numerous PCODE errors, unknown exceptions, and generally wacky things happening before the server eventually crashed (process died).
